If you've received a call or message from the number 02 8529 5789, you might want to pay close attention. Based on user reports, this number falls into the category of suspicious communication, possibly leading to a scam attempt.
Multiple users have filed complaints regarding this number. The messages sent from it include vague prompts, such as urging the recipient to contact them “as soon as possible” and referencing an “English Chinese department.” Another report mentioned that the caller claimed to be contacting the individual regarding an “endemic situation,” with calls to action prompting recipients to press specific numbers. This kind of messaging is a common tactic used by scam callers to create urgency and confusion.
Given the nature of these reports, it’s reasonable to conclude that 02 8529 5789 is potentially linked to scam activities. Scammers often utilise tactics like false urgency and ambiguous language to elicit responses, hoping to trick the recipient into revealing personal information or confirming their identities.
When dealing with calls from unknown numbers that leave suspicious messages, here are a few guidelines to consider:
- Do Not Respond: Avoid pressing any buttons or returning calls. Engaging with the caller may lead to further invasion of your privacy.
- Block the Number: If you identify any number as suspicious, it's best to block it to avoid future contact and potential scams.
- Utilise a Reverse Phone Lookup: If you're unsure who called, use a service like Reverseau to investigate the caller further.
- Spread the Word: Share your experience so others can be cautious of similar scams.
